What Services Do Middletown Plumbers Offer?
Leak Repair
Leaky pipes result in higher water bills, and not fixing them promptly can damage the surrounding area. Professional plumbers have the tools and knowledge to pinpoint leak locations and patch them at their sources.
Clog Repair
Congested drains and pipes may lead to flooding, backflow, and damage. Area plumbers can remove obstructions and give you expert advice to prevent them later on.
Pipe Replacement
With time, pipes wear out and get damaged. Luckily, modern and robust pipe brands and materials can last long and stay strong. Plumbers can inspect aging, leaking, and bursting and replace pipes to help you prevent snowballing issues.
Fixture Installation
Some fixtures wear down with age and require replacement. Other times, you may replace them as part of a renovation. A plumber can install something as simple as a new faucet or as complex as a new toilet, shower, sink, or bathtub.
Gas Repair
In addition to typical plumbing services, some professionals are trained to fix home gas leaks from appliances such as ovens and radiators. If you detect the scent of a gas leak, exit your house right away and notify your utility provider.
Annual Inspections
Plumbing systems must withstand component damage from consistent daily use. Protect your home's pipes by arranging regular checkups from an expert Middletown plumber. Inspections can uncover problems while they’re still minor, and spotting and repairing them early may lower your long-term repair bills.
Emergency Services
Burst pipes and backfilling toilets never wait for an appropriate time, so many plumbers offer emergency services. Emergency repairs will be more expensive than scheduled ones, but they're sometimes necessary to prevent serious damage.
Cost of Plumbing Services in Middletown
Middletown plumbers typically charge between $102 and $340 for installation and repair work. Emergency jobs will almost always incur additional charges. Use the table below for specific cost data on common plumbing services in Middletown.
| Project | Estimated Cost |
|---|---|
| Clog and drain clearing | $72 - $360 |
| Leak repair | $108 - $324 |
| Burst pipe repair | $780 - $3,119 |
| Faucet installation | $129 - $516 |
| Toilet installation | $289 - $771 |
| Pipe rerouting | $602 - $1,290 |
| Main water line repair | $404 - $3,231 |
| Water heater repair | $117 - $585 |
| Water heater installation | $771 - $1,928 |
| Water softener installation | $204 - $510 |
Check Licensing and Insurance
Plumbers in Pennsylvania don't need state licenses to do their jobs. However, local governments frequently issue their own credentials and licenses. We recommend contacting Middletown officials for more information on the city's requirements. Your plumber should also be bonded and insured. This is a sign the company backs its work, and if accidents or damage arise, you'll be safer financially.
Check Union Status
Not every plumber is union, but many are. Union plumbers typically charge more for labor, but these companies also have stronger vetting and training practices.
Assess Their Experience
Choose a plumber with a long track record of local work. Smaller companies based in Middletown will often be more familiar with residents' most common plumbing complaints. More experience also means the team could solve your problem faster.
Read Customer Reviews
Read through customer reviews on sites like the Better Business Bureau (BBB) and Google Reviews. Pay attention to what past clients have said about a plumber's customer service and workmanship.
Compare Multiple Quotes
Seek out multiple estimates for your project to figure out approximate local market rates. Avoid choosing companies that charge too high or too low for their services. If a quote looks "too good to be true," it probably is.
Ask About Warranties and Guarantees
Ask each plumbing company if it backs its workmanship with a warranty. Newly installed fixtures and appliances might also include manufacturer warranties that protect you from product defects.
